music.wikisort.org - Composition"Big Time" is a song by Italian Eurodance project Whigfield which was performed by Danish-born singer Sannie Charlotte Carlson.[1] It was released in July 1995, by X-Energy Records as the fifth single from her debut album, Whigfield (1995). It peaked at number 21 in the UK, giving her another big hit in that country. For the British market the song was released as a double A-side single together with "Last Christmas", a cover of the English duo Wham!. In other countries, "Big Time" peaked within the top 20 in Denmark, Italy, the Netherlands and Spain..

Critical reception
A reviewer from The Guardian described the song as "cute".[2] Pan-European magazine Music & Media compared it to Swedish band Ace Of Base, writing, "When the cat's away—that's Ace Of Base—the mice will play. And they're having a big time with a pop reggae song ready for summer chart domination."[3] Music Week commented, "Hedging her bets, Whiggy releases a drippy cut from her debut album, alongside a corny version of the Wham! festive fave."[4]
"Big Time" went on becoming a moderate hit in Europe, peaking within the Top 20 in Denmark, Italy, the Netherlands and Spain. Additionally, it was a Top 30 hit in Flemish Belgium, Ireland, Scotland and the UK. In the latter, the song was released as a double single with Whigfield's cover of "Last Christmas" by Wham!. It peaked at number 21 on the UK Singles Chart on December 10, 1995,[5] in its first week at the chart. In Germany, it reached number 50 and on the Eurochart Hot 100, it went to number 54. Outside Europe, the single was a Top 30 hit on the RPM Dance/Urban chart in Canada, peaking at number 22.
Music video
In the music video for "Big Time" Whigfield walks in a deserted countryside with a shopping cart with foods. She wears a red dress. A white cabriolet with three girls are passing by and Whigfield goes with them. Other scenes show Whigfield singing while standing on a wrecking ball. She and the girls also stops at a car repair shop to get the car fixed. Then they drive on. At the end the shopping cart is being emptied from a rock crush. The video was uploaded to YouTube in March 2013.[6]
